简介
SQL Server Express(简称SQL Express)是Microsoft推出的一款免费、轻量级的数据库管理系统。它非常适合新手学习和开发,同时也适用于小型项目。本文将为您介绍SQL Server Express的基本知识,并解答一些常见问题。
一、SQL Server Express概述
1.1 什么是SQL Server Express?
SQL Server Express是一个功能完整的数据库管理系统,但它免费且资源占用较小。它包括SQL Server的核心功能,如数据存储、检索、事务处理等。
1.2 适用场景
- 教育和自学
- 小型项目开发
- 个人或团队协作
二、安装SQL Server Express
2.1 下载
访问Microsoft官方网站下载最新版本的SQL Server Express。
2.2 安装
- 运行安装程序。
- 选择“安装SQL Server数据库引擎服务”。
- 选择“SQL Server Express”。
- 按照提示完成安装。
三、SQL Server Express使用教程
3.1 创建数据库
- 打开SQL Server Management Studio(SSMS)。
- 连接到本地实例(默认为“SQLEXPRESS”)。
- 在“对象资源管理器”中,右键单击“数据库”,选择“新建数据库”。
- 输入数据库名称,选择文件路径和大小,点击“OK”。
3.2 创建表
- 在对象资源管理器中,找到刚创建的数据库。
- 右键单击“表”,选择“新建表”。
- 在表设计器中,输入列名、数据类型等属性。
- 点击“保存”并关闭设计器。
3.3 插入数据
- 在查询编辑器中输入以下SQL语句:
INSERT INTO 表名(列1, 列2, ...) VALUES(值1, 值2, ...) - 按下F5执行查询。
3.4 查询数据
- 在查询编辑器中输入以下SQL语句:
SELECT * FROM 表名 - 按下F5执行查询。
四、常见问题解答
4.1 为什么我的SQL Server Express无法连接?
- 确保SQL Server服务正在运行。
- 检查防火墙设置,确保端口1433被允许。
4.2 如何备份和还原数据库?
在SSMS中,找到要备份的数据库。
右键单击数据库,选择“任务” > “备份”。
选择备份类型,设置备份文件路径,点击“OK”。
在SSMS中,找到要还原的数据库。
右键单击数据库,选择“任务” > “还原”。
选择“数据库”,点击“OK”。
4.3 如何优化查询性能?
- 确保使用合适的索引。
- 避免使用SELECT *。
- 优化查询语句。
五、总结
SQL Server Express是一款功能强大的数据库管理系统,适合新手学习和开发。通过本文的教程,相信您已经掌握了SQL Server Express的基本操作。在今后的学习和工作中,多加练习,相信您会越来越熟练。
